<time dir="rl_02b"></time><address draggable="fr8sks"></address><acronym lang="io1eyr"></acronym><small dir="mba98i"></small><var lang="jnj5a8"></var><legend date-time="pcrcrd"></legend><time lang="0h5m_g"></time><sub draggable="cx1n6r"></sub>

TP钱包闪退的全面分析:从随机数安全到行业未来

引言

TP钱包闪退(应用非正常退出)是用户常见的体验问题,但其背后可能涉及程序稳定性、加密安全、系统兼容和隐私合规等多重因素。本文围绕闪退的技术成因、随机数预测风险、全球化智能技术的应用、安全支付认证机制、新兴技术带来的变革、个人信息保护与行业未来展开分析,并给出面向开发者与用户的可行建议。

一、闪退的常见技术原因

- 应用层缺陷:内存泄漏、空指针、并发竞态、资源释放不当等会导致崩溃。第三方SDK(如加密库、广告或统计模块)也常是崩溃来源。

- 平台兼容性:不同操作系统版本、定制ROM或厂商安全机制可能引发异常。

- 运行时环境:权限不足、文件损坏、数据库迁移失败或网络异常都可能触发闪退。

- 加密/签名流程:密钥加载失败、签名算法错误或硬件安全模块(Secure Element)交互异常也会导致关键路径崩溃。

二、随机数预测的安全风险(高层说明,避免可被滥用细节)

随机数在钱包中用于密钥生成、签名随机因子、一次性令牌等。若随机源可被预测,攻击者可恢复私钥或重复签名,从而导致资产被盗。常见风险点包括可复现的种子、熵不足、依赖不安全的伪随机算法或错误的系统初始化。防护方向应包括使用经审计的加密安全随机数生成器(CSPRNG)、引入足够硬件/环境熵源、避免可预测的种子来源以及限定随机相关操作的上下文权限。

三、全球化智能技术的作用

- 智能化崩溃检测:通过机器学习对崩溃堆栈聚类、自动定位问题模式,加速问题修复。

- 远程诊断与灰度发布:利用智能回放与遥测数据在全球不同地区小范围推送,验证修复有效性并规避大规模故障。

- 本地化与合规适配:面向不同法律环境(例如GDPR、数据出境限制)智能调整数据收集与存储策略。

四、安全支付认证与多层防护

- 多因子与设备绑定:结合设备指纹、生物特征、PIN码实现多层认证,降低单点妥协风险。

- 硬件隔离与签名确认:采用安全元件(TEE/SE)或硬件钱包进行私钥隔离与确认,减少应用闪退或被劫持时的暴露面。

- 多签与门限签名:通过多方共识或门限签名技术分散密钥控制,提高单一组件故障时的资产安全性。

五、新兴技术革命的影响

门限签名、多方安全计算(MPC)、零知识证明(ZK)和可信执行环境等技术正推动钱包架构从单一私钥向分布式、可证明安全的方向演进。它们能在提升安全性的同时改善用户体验(例如免托管但可恢复的密钥管理)。同时,基于AI的自动化测试和代码审计正在缩短安全修复周期。

六、个人信息的保护要点

- 最小化收集:仅收集功能必要的数据,减少长期储存敏感信息。

- 本地优先与加密存储:尽可能把敏感数据留在设备并使用强加密;服务器端存储应加密并做访问控制与审计。

- 透明与用户控制:明确告知数据用途,提供导出/删除与权限管理入口,满足不同司法辖区合规要求。

七、行业未来与建议

行业将朝着标准化、安全联邦化与去中心化辅助的方向发展:更强的跨链与互操作标准、更成熟的门限/多签解决方案、广泛采用安全硬件与更智能的运维工具。监管与合规会推动认证规范化,用户教育与可恢复性设计(例如社会恢复、分片备份)将成为竞争要素。

八、落地建议

- 开发者:使用经审计的CSPRNG与硬件熵源,强化异常捕获与崩溃上报,定期第三方安全审计与模糊测试,合理隔离第三方SDK权限并灰度发布更新。

- 用户:保持应用与系统更新,优先启用硬件钱包或多签托管大额资产,关注权限与安装来源,遇到闪退先尝试清理缓存或重装并联系官方支持后再做更改。

结语

TP钱包闪退表面上是稳定性问题,但其牵涉到随机数安全、支付认证、隐私保护与更广泛的技术与合规生态。通过技术改进、流程管控与行业协作,可以在提升用户体验的同时显著降低安全风险,迎接新兴技术带来的变革。

作者:陈思远发布时间:2025-09-14 15:15:14

评论

Alex1988

写得很全面,特别是关于随机数风险和硬件隔离的部分,受益匪浅。

小林

作为普通用户,最关注的是遇到闪退该怎么稳妥处置,文章的建议很实用。

CryptoFan

希望更多钱包厂商能把门限签名和TEE落地,兼顾安全与易用性。

数据娜娜

关于全球化合规和智能崩溃检测的讨论很及时,尤其是对多区域灰度发布的提醒。

相关阅读